General Upgrading Tips:

Whenever possible, try to 𓄧upgrade Capacity for your weapons when they are out 

of ammo. 🉐 Doing so will give you a full clip of ammo, plus the upgraded 

amount.  Same wiꦜth upgr♏ading Health on the Rig.  When you upgrade an HP node 

on the Rig, you will fully regenerate all lost ꩵhealth including the health 

you just upgraded.

Upgrades:

DMG = Base 10, with 4 upgrades of 2 damage each.

CAP = Base 10, with 5 upgrades of 2 moreᩚᩚᩚᩚᩚᩚ⁤⁤⁤⁤ᩚ⁤⁤𓄧⁤⁤ᩚ⁤⁤⁤⁤ᩚ𒀱ᩚᩚᩚ shots each.

REL = Base 1 second reload, with 2 upgrades o𒉰f -0.25 seconds each.

SPD = Base 1 second fire time, with𓂃 2 upgrades of -0.2 seconds each.

SPC = Unlocking this adds fire damage to the Plasma C🅰utter with each shot.

Upgrade Tips:

F✱ocus on getting the Damage upgrades.  Speed and Reload are less crucial to 

the Plasma C👍utter than Damage is. &nb𓃲sp;Several Capacity upgrades can be picked up 

when you are out of ammo for a full reload plus two more shots🃏. &⭕nbsp;The Special 

is nice, but not worth rushing to get.

Upgrades:

DMG = Base 5, with 4 upgrades of 1 damage each.

CAP = Base 50, with 5 upgrades of 25 ammo each.

REL = Base 1.4 seconds, with 2 upgrades o♚f -0.2 seco🌜nds each.

ALT = Base 3, with 4 upgrades of 1 point each.

Upgrade Tips:

Upgrade the🍸 capacity of this the first time, trying to get the first three 

damage nodes.  The power of the Pulse Rifle comes from a large clip, so&nbs♐p;

continually focus on getting Capacity upgrades when yo🌠u run out of ammo for♋ a 

largeᩚᩚᩚᩚᩚᩚ⁤⁤⁤⁤ᩚ⁤⁤⁤⁤ᩚ⁤⁤⁤⁤ᩚ𒀱ᩚᩚᩚ boost in ammunition each upgrade.  Save the Alt Fire upgrades for last 

unl🦋ess you heavi🥃ly rely on grenades instead of bullets.

Upgrades:

DMG = Base 15, with 4 upgrades of 3 points each.

CAP =🐲 Base 5, with 4 upgrades of 1 more ammo each.

REL = Base 1, with♚🌺 2 upgrades of -0.15 seconds each.

WID = Base 1, with 2 upgrades of +50% width each.

ALT = Base 20, with 6 upgrades of +5 damage each.

DUR = Shortens the timer for the Alt Fire Mine det🤪onation.

Upgrade Tips:

The Line gun shines mostly in it's wide pattern and ability to🐼 "knee-cap" 

enemies in a preferably a single shot.  In order to best accomplish this, i🧔t 

is bes꧑t to upgrade Width and damage as soon as possible.  The Alt Fire mine 

is quite devastatin♛g once fully upgraded and🦩 the timer shortened, though I 

feel as if this mode of fire isn't what the gun is best intende🅰d for.

Upgrades:

DMG = Base 4, with 2 upgrades of 4 points each.

CAP = Base 50, with 5 upgrades of 25 ammo each.

REL = Base 1, with 3 upgrad𝕴es at -0.15 seconds 💎each.

DUR = Base 5, with 2 upgrades of 5 additi🀅onal seconds ♐each.

ALT = Base 1, with 4 upgrades of 1 each.

Upgrade Tips:

The Flamethr🎀ower is very similar to the Pul𒁏se Rifle, except it scales in 

damage much faster.🌃  It burns through ammo quickly🔴 however, unlike being able 

to properly do spurt damage in key locཧations.  So you will probably have to ﷽;

upgrade capacity quite frequently, which thank🥃f💎ully happens as along the 

natural upgrade🧔 path.  Upgrade Alternate Fire separately if you prefer that 

weapon mode.

Upgrades:

DMG = Base 8, with 4 upgrades of 2 damage each.

CAP = Base 8, with 4 upgrad❀es of 2 more ammo each.

REL = Base 1, with 2 upgrades of -0.2💖 seconds each.

DUR = Base 5 seconds, with ෴2 upgrades of 2 seconds ♒each.

ALT = Base 20 damage, with 4 upgrades of 2.5 damage eac💝h.

Upgrade Tips:

꧃The Ripper is a comperable weapon to the Plasma Cutter.  I would not focus&n🅺bsp;

upgrading both weapons together. &n🅰bsp;Damage and Duration are the more important 

nodes to focus on wꩵith the Ripper as tha🌄t is where the bulk of it's power 

c🌳omesꦗ from.  Alternate Fire route can be maxed early if you prefer shooting 

blades.

Upgrades:

ALT = Base 10, with♔ 4 upgrades of 1.5 damage each.

SPD = Base 1, with 2 upgrades of -0.2 ꦅseconds each.

DMG = Bawse 50, 4 upgrades of 12.5 damage each.

CAPꦉ = Base 5, with 5 upgrades of 1 more ammo each.

SPC = Ca♈uses the Alternate Fire do explosive damage as w꧃ell as shock.

REL = Base 1.5, with 2 upgrades of -0.25 seconds🅺 each.

Upgrade Tips:

Capacity for this weapon is worth jumping aheཧad of instead of waiting for n🐼o 

ammo moments.  The gun'ಌs primary and alternate fire modes offer a one-two 

punch which consumes ammo in even amounts fairly quic♕kly.  At the very least, 

attempt to have an even number o🐬f shots in your gun 🌠to avoid firing and 

loꦓsing an alternate fire shot.  If you are rushing the Sp♏ecial node, you will 

get y꧋our one Capacity for 6 total shots early on in theꦕ gun's build.

Upgrades:

REL = Base 1, with 🌸3 upgrades of -0.15 seconds each.

CAP = Base 3, with 4 upgrades of 1 ammo each.

DMG = Base 20, with💟 4 upgrades of +2.5 damage each.

SPC = Increases the damage radius of the mines.

Upgrade Tips:

Damage is the only thing that mattersꦇ besides the special bonus.  These are 

weapons you try to plant when you know you are abouღt to be🅠 attacked and have 

some preparation time.  You can fire off you🙈r mines, recollect them without 

reloading, and then upgrade your 𝓀Capacity and increase y🎐our Mine count.

Upgrades:

DMG = Base 20, with 5 upgrades of 3 each.

CAP = Base 5, with 5 upgrades of 1 ammo each.

REL = Base 2,ꦇ with 2 upgr🌞ades of -0.25 seconds each.

SܫPD = Base 1, with 2 upgrades of -0.2 secon🌠ds each.

ALT = Base 10, with 4 upgrades of 5 damage each.

Upgrade Tips:

The gun serves bes෴t as a pushing weapon for those moments that🤪 you feel 

claustrophobic, however the Alt Fire is a good weapon to take down Necros in&🍨nbsp;

one or two shots i💫f you have good aim.  Upgrading, you can pick up the෴ Alt 

Fire Nodes relatively early and✤ then finish off the rest of the 💟branches 

separately.

Upgrades:

DMG = Base 50, with 4 upgrades of 5 each.

REL = Base 1, with 3 upgrades of -0.15 seconds e♊ach.

🌠CAP = Base 4 rounds, with 3 upgrades of 1 more ammo each.

ALT = Base 50, with 4 upgrades of 12.🎶5 increased scoဣping damage.

Upgrade Tips:

The Scoped damage accelerates faster th✱an the standard damage does.  If you 

are good at scoping and firing quickl🤪y, you m𝓰ay want to upgrade the Alternate 

Fire mode first.  Enemies die quickly to this weapon even with limited da🔥mage 

upgradin🌳g, so it mꦺay be worthwhile to upgrade Capacity and Reload speed over

Damage first.

Upgrades:

REL = Base 1, ꧅with 4 upgrades of ꦆ-0.25 seconds each.

CAP = Base 4, with 3 upgrades of 1 ammo each.

CHR = Base 0.8, with 2 upgrades of -0.2 seconds.

🔯SPC = A🔯lternate Fire adds Stasis effect to enemies hit.

ALT = Base 1, with 4 upgrades of 1 each.

Upgrade Tips:

Reload sꦜpeed is an absolu💦te must for this weapon.  The Alternate Fire, 

especially after the Stasis upgrade, is extre💃mely useful.  🎀;If you use 

this weapon for it's control purposes,♈ consider focusing most your early 

nodes to that part of the branch.

Upgrades:

DUR = Base 8, with 4 upgrades of 2 each.

ENG = Base 40, with 2 upgrades of 20 each (essentailly 2 us🍸es, with 2 more).

CHR = Base 1𝐆00 seconds, with 2 upgrades of -10 seconds each.

Upgrade Tips:

Stasis is the most important tool in Isaac's reperto😼𒆙ire.  Upgrading the uses 

is the most important effect൩ to focus first🐼, so grab the Energy upgrades as 

soon as possible.  🍌Charge time reduction is the least important attribute.

Upgrades:

HP 𓄧 = Base 100 health, with 4 upgrades of 25 health each.

DMG = Base 1 of Telekine🐈sis, with 2 upgrades of +50% strength each.

AIR = Base 120 seco𓂃nds of oxygen time, with 3 upgrades of +20 seconds each.

Upgrade Tips:

Air is worth🍸less and should be your last upgrade.  You can never have too 

much health, so upgrade that first, unless you like to use Tele🐻kin🍷esis alot 

in which case, spread the nodes between damage🌳 and hp🍸.
